The North Indian dhol-tasha drumming custom was unfold globally because of the British indenture-ship process, which commenced from the 1830s and despatched an incredible number of Adult men, Gals, and kids to work in agricultural and industrial colonies throughout the world. Though distinctive dhol-tasha variants emerged in lots of areas exactly where indentured laborers settled, probably the most vibrant of such is tassa drumming from the southern Caribbean region of Trinidad and Tobago.

Performed by utilizing a bamboo keep on with bare fingers, the Assamese dhol is manufactured up of the picket barrel With all the ends lined principally with animal disguise (unlike the rest of the Indian subcontinent, exactly where it could be a synthetic skin also), that will either be stretched or loosened by tightening the interwoven straps. The dhol player is termed Dhulia and also the specialist in dhol is termed Ojah (Assamese: ওজা).

The drum includes a wooden barrel with animal conceal or synthetic pores and skin stretched in excess of its open up ends, covering them completely. These skins can be stretched or loosened with a tightening system made up of possibly interwoven ropes, or nuts and bolts. Tightening or loosening the skins subtly alters the pitch of your drum audio. The stretched skin on one of the finishes is thicker and makes a deep, very low-frequency (increased bass) audio and the other thinner one provides an increased-frequency audio. Dhols with synthetic, or plastic, treble skins are typical.
